      I applied through a recruiter.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Whisper (Los Angeles, CA) in Apr 2016

      Interview

      Applied online; no call with recruiter; just straight to hiring manager. It would have been nice to get an understanding of the hiring process through the recruiter. They are pretty fast at hiring decisions. They turned me down for a position but a couple weeks later, I saw that the position was posted again. They seem to be one of those companies that are looking for a perfect candidate and have the job open indefinitely. Considering they aren't exactly leaders in social media, they should perhaps re-think that strategy and train hirees.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Fav product? Why you like it? Tell me about a time you built a product at your former employer.

      I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Whisper (Venice, LA) in Mar 2016

      Interview

      High Level questions about the product and how to improve it.. flew me out for interview but interview process seemed less organized than I expected. They cut the interview short and mentioned this wasn't a good "fit" (whatever that means). I was happy they cut it short rather than wasting more of either parties' time. While I sensed this was not a good fit for me either, it would have been helpful if the company provided a reason as to why.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Why do you want to work at Whisper?
